Abstract

The invention provides an optical digital relay protection tester detection apparatus. The optical digital relay protection tester detection apparatus is characterized by comprising a main system, an optical switch, a signal capture analysis module and a small-signal detection module. When the optical digital relay protection tester detection apparatus is used for detecting, the main system gives a work instruction to the detected optical digital relay protection tester; the optical digital relay protection tester gives an optical signal to the optical switch; the optical switch converts the optical signal into a digital signal and gives the digital signal to the signal capture and analysis module; the signal capture and analysis module captures, analyzes and decodes the digital single; the analyzed and decoded digital signal is transmitted to the main system for operation, and a test result is displayed by the main system. The optical digital relay protection tester detection apparatus can perform automatic detection on the optical digital relay protection tester, and fills a technology gap that no effective equipment for detecting the optical digital relay protection tester is provided in the prior art. Through the effective detection of the optical digital relay protection tester, the safe and stable operation of an electric power system is maximally guaranteed.
